Srinagar, Apr 6: Jammu and Kashmir People’s Conference (JKPC) chief and MLA Handwara, Sajad Gani Lone, has criticized what he termed as “selective action” in mining operations in District Kupwara.
Lone said while local residents face punishment for transporting even a tractor-load of sand or aggregate, large companies like Choudhary Power Projects Pvt. Ltd. (GECPL) are allowed to carry out large-scale mining without checks.
“This is not governance. This is legalized plunder. Locals are harassed while companies enjoy free rein,” he said.
Lone urged the administration to ensure fair treatment and stop what he described as a “license to loot” for corporate entities. (KNS)
